Ion acoustic waves excited by large amplitude electron plasma wave were found in the VLF wide band spectrograms whose spectra are very similar to those obtained by the K-9M-35 nonlinear wave-wave interaction experiment. In addition to these, banded LHR emissions were observed throughout the experimental period which, at a certain altitude, triggered 'risers' whose spectrum is very similar to that of ASE. After the electron beam with energy lower than 3 eV is ejected, periodic U-shaped discrete emissions were observed. The frequency of these emissions is lower than LHR frequency and decreases as the beam energy is increased.
